You can cook Protein banana cookies using 8 ingredients and 8 steps. Here is how you cook it.
Ingredients of Protein banana cookies
- It's 2 of med very ripe bananas.
- You need 1-1/2 cups of rolled oats.
- You need 1/3 cup of dark chocolate chips.
- It's 1/8 teaspoons of cinnamon.
- It's 2 tablespoons of shilved Almonds.
- You need 1/2 teaspoon of vanilla.
- You need 1 scoop of vanilla protein i used level1 -link on my profile.
- It's 1 tbs of monkfruit sweetener.

Protein banana cookies instructions
- Pre heat ove at 375°.
- On a cookie sheet line with foil and spray with cooking spray..
- In a bowl add ripe bananas and swash with the back of a fork. Mix in vanilla, protein, and sweetener.
- Add oats and gently stir till well combined. Should look like a thick cookie batter..
- Add mix ins ; chocolate chips almonds and cinnamon.
- Scoop 1 heaping tablespoon on a greased cookie sheet lighly press down to form a cookie..
- Bake for 10-12 min till the edges are golden..
- Cool..and enjoy.
